
The common rosefinch (Carpodacus erythrinus) or scarlet rosefinch, female.
These birds live everywhere, and their funny singing can be heard in mid-late May. They feed mainly on trees and shrubs, but very rarely can descend to the ground. Obviously, in order to drink the dew.
Females also sing songs, and it seems their songs are not similar to the songs of males, but I could be wrong, since these birds have several kinds of songs.
